Meaning of non-athlete
A person who does not engage in athletic activities or sports.
Etymology of non-athlete
The term "non-athlete" is a combination of the prefix "non-" meaning "not" or "opposite of" and the word "athlete," which originates from the Greek word "athlētēs," meaning "prizefighter" or "contestant in the public games."
The word "athlete" has its roots in ancient Greece, where athletes competed in various sports and games, and over time, the term has evolved to encompass a broader range of physical activities and competitions.
